Output 304c10d85abeb69a1e8550e0bce84b04b522c5f0ee6ca26eaae91c8d26bf8ecd:1

value
4363025405
script pubkey
OP_0 OP_PUSHBYTES_20 188c38a46fd0783df83523f469181d2245002a34
address
tb1qrzxr3fr06purm7p4y06xjxqayfzsq235s92hlq
transaction
304c10d85abeb69a1e8550e0bce84b04b522c5f0ee6ca26eaae91c8d26bf8ecd
confirmations
105973
spent
true